Job Responsibilities:This position requires the planning and execution of diverse civil engineering projects. It will serve as the project lead and work with the engineering team to provide state of the art engineering and construction solutions to clients by leading in the preparation and design of site development plans, reports, and specifications for residential, commercial, and industrial projects. It will also provide a varied work environment that allows you plenty of chances to get out of the office and into the field.Duties:
  • Prepare preliminary and final design work for site development projects.
  • Perform storm drainage, water, and sewer calculations and reports.
  • Create complex construction drawings and details using AutoCAD or Carlson applications.
  • Oversee sub-consultants
  • Provide due diligence and feasibility studies
  • Manage all aspects of project development from programming through construction administration
  • Create and track project budgets, proposals, and schedules
  • Manage client relations
Required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's Degree in Civil Engineering from an accredited College/University
  • 3+ years of experience
  • EIT or PE license
  • Ability to collaborate with in-house Engineers, Landscape Architects, and Surveyors.
  • Must have a valid US Driver's License.
